The TLV5619IDW from Texas Instruments is a precision digital-to-analog converter (DAC) that offers outstanding performance and flexibility, making it an ideal choice for a wide range of applications. This integrated circuit is designed to meet the rigorous demands of industrial, communication, and consumer electronics systems.
Key Features
- Resolution: The TLV5619IDW features a 12-bit resolution which provides fine granularity, ensuring accurate analog output for precise control and measurement tasks.
- Dual-Channel Output: It comes with two DAC channels, allowing for simultaneous output of two independent analog signals. This dual-channel capability is perfect for applications requiring multiple analog outputs from a single digital source.
- Interface: The device includes a versatile 3-wire serial interface that is compatible with SPI, QSPI™, MICROWIRE™, and DSP interface standards, ensuring easy integration into a variety of system designs.
- Settling Time: With a fast settling time, the TLV5619IDW quickly reaches a stable output after a data change, which is crucial for time-sensitive applications.
- Power Supply: It operates from a 2.7V to 5.5V power supply, making it suitable for both low-power and standard logic level applications.
- Package: The device is offered in a SOIC package, providing a compact footprint for space-constrained applications.
